Come see the grandeur of An Tir as she prepares for her next
ruler. In addition to the Crown Tournament (Come cheer
for your favorite participant), there will be a Squire’s
Tourney. Equestrian Activities, Archery (including York
Round), Arts and Sciences Displays, Tournaments, and other
activities
